A New Reference of Innovative Gastronomy in Aruba
(Oranjestad)–The St. Regis Aruba Resort proudly announces the official opening of its exclusive rooftop restaurant: Akira Back. Led by world-renowned Chef Akira Back, this is the brand’s first restaurant in Latin America. Located within Aruba’s luxurious new resort, Chef Back and his team serve a sophisticated fusion of Japanese influences with vibrant Korean flavors, showcasing a rich culture in every dish.
Inspired by Aruba’s natural beauty and the refined art of Asian cuisine, guests enjoyed an innovative interpretation of steak and sushi that transcends culinary borders.

Chef Back curated a menu that pays homage to his heritage and the inspirations that have shaped his culinary style. Highlights among the appetizers include:
- Akira Back Tuna Pizza with Umami Aioli, Micro Shiso, and White Truffle Oil
- Wagyu Bulgogi Taco with Tomato Ponzu
- A classic Yellowtail Carpaccio with Jalapeño Sauce and Blood Orange Soy
Sushi lovers shouldn’t miss his famous creations such as Hot Mess (Crab Tempura, Avocado, Sashimi Poke, and Marinated Seaweed) or Cow Wow (Braised Short Rib with Asian Slaw).
For main courses, the restaurant offers selections of Japanese A5 Wagyu or other premium meats, all served with his signature blend of salt and butter. For seafood lovers:
- Miso Butterfish
- Lobster Tail with Truffle Potato Foam and Mango Papaya Hot Sauce Reduction (inspired by Aruba)
- King Crab Merus with Garlic Butter and Chili Aioli – all must-tries.
Akira Back restaurant also offers Japan-inspired cocktails like the Japanese Lemon Drop and Omija Sunset, along with a selection of sake, shochu, wines, and other premium liquors.
The restaurant’s décor includes artwork by his mother, Young Hee, a recognized artist whose colorful designs decorate the dining room and even feature on personalized plates.
Chef Akira Back is considered one of the global leaders in modern Asian cuisine. Since opening in Seoul with a Michelin star, his portfolio now includes 25 restaurants around the world – Aruba is his first in the Caribbean.
